首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将具有th:action的表单附加到输入onfocusout

将具有th:action的表单附加到输入onfocusout的方法是通过使用JavaScript来实现。具体步骤如下:

  1. 首先,在HTML中定义一个表单,并设置th:action属性为表单提交的目标URL。例如:
代码语言:txt
复制
<form th:action="@{/submit}" method="post" id="myForm">
    <!-- 表单内容 -->
</form>
  1. 接下来,给需要附加onfocusout事件的输入框添加一个唯一的id属性。例如:
代码语言:txt
复制
<input type="text" id="myInput" onfocusout="attachForm()" />
  1. 在JavaScript中编写attachForm函数,该函数将在输入框失去焦点时被调用。在该函数中,使用JavaScript的DOM操作将表单附加到输入框上。例如:
代码语言:txt
复制
function attachForm() {
    var form = document.getElementById("myForm");
    var input = document.getElementById("myInput");
    input.appendChild(form);
}
  1. 最后,确保在页面加载完成时调用attachForm函数,以便将表单正确附加到输入框上。可以使用以下代码:
代码语言:txt
复制
window.onload = function() {
    attachForm();
};

这样,当输入框失去焦点时,具有th:action的表单将会被附加到输入框上。

请注意,以上代码仅为示例,实际使用时需要根据具体情况进行调整。此外,腾讯云提供了丰富的云计算产品,可以根据具体需求选择适合的产品。具体产品介绍和相关链接可以参考腾讯云官方网站。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券